Your yearly chance of being a victim of assault in Hattiesburg is about 1 in 1,160.
Assault costs the average Hattiesburg resident about $25 per year.
Crime Grade's assault map shows the safest places in Hattiesburg in green. The most dangerous areas in Hattiesburg are in red, with moderately safe areas in yellow. Crime rates on the map are weighted by the type and severity of the crime.
The A- grade means the rate of assault is lower than the average US city. Hattiesburg is in the 78th percentile for safety, meaning 22% of cities are safer and 78% of cities are more dangerous. This analysis applies to Hattiesburg's proper boundaries only. See the table on nearby places below for nearby cities.
The rate of assault in Hattiesburg is 0.8624 per 1,000 residents during a standard year. People who live in Hattiesburg generally consider the southwest part of the city to be the safest.
Your chance of being a victim of assault in Hattiesburg may be as high as 1 in 420 in the northeast neighborhoods, or as low as 1 in 2,502 in the southwest part of the city.
By a simple count ignoring population, more assault occurs in the northwest parts of Hattiesburg, MS: about 14 per year. The northeast part of Hattiesburg has fewer cases of assault with only 5 in a typical year.
The chart below compares the assault rate in Hattiesburg to the Mississippi state average and the national average. All rates are the number of crimes per 1,000 residents in a standard year.
| Hattiesburg, MS: | 0.8624 |
|---|---|
| Mississippi: | 0.9615 |
| USA: | 2.561 |
Considering only the assault rate, Hattiesburg is safer than the Mississippi state average and safer than the national average.
